**Mgmt Meeting Minutes — Retiring the Brightline Range**

Quick recap for sales leads at Fenholt Supplies: we agreed to retire the Brightline fixture range by year-end. Remaining stock moves to clearance pricing next month, and accounts on standing orders get migrated to the Lumetta range. Trade-in incentives were approved in principle. The confidential note on next steps sits just below.

board note of bajof-bajeg: The pricing group signed off on a budget of $13.4 million for Project Sildor. The renewal with Lamixek Holdings closes at $48.9 million a year, 49 percent above the last contract.

## Service Account: canary-gater

Welcome to the Thornquist deploy platform. The canary-gater account evaluates gating rules before any canary is promoted: error-rate deltas, latency percentiles, and manual holds set by release captains. It runs every five minutes and writes verdicts to the Promotion Ledger. The account has read access to metrics and write access to gate decisions only. New members testing locally should authenticate with the key below.

app token of kafop-hahaf = kto11_iRLdsMBafGn

### Changelog — Validex Core 2.9.0

**Changed defaults: validator plugin loading**

The plugin system for data validators now loads plugins lazily instead of eagerly at startup. This reduces boot time and means a broken validator no longer blocks unrelated pipelines. Strict mode, previously opt-in, is now the default: unknown validator names fail the run instead of being silently skipped. Reviewers should check that downstream configs don't rely on the old skip behavior. The new default configuration shipped with this release is as follows.

deployment values, kajep-kageg:
[praix]
host = praix.paliqcorp.corp
user = praix_svc
database = praix_prod

## Onboarding: Parity between Brindle-iOS and Brindle-Android SDKs

Context for the weekly eng sync: the two Brindle client SDKs are tracked against a shared parity matrix. Android currently lags on offline caching; iOS lags on event batching. To run the parity test harness locally, copy `env.sample` to `.env` and fill in the non-secret vars per the matrix doc. The harness also needs the parity-service auth secret, set on the following line:

sealed setting: LEDGER_TOKEN5=bcca1